Possible Causes of Dishwasher Overflow

Dishwasher overflows are often caused by simple malfunctions such as blocked drainage pipes or faulty door seals. When the drainage system becomes clogged or the door seal fails, excess water can escape and flood the surrounding areas, leading to significant water damage if not addressed promptly.

Another common cause is a malfunctioning float switch or control board that causes the dishwasher to overfill. Age, debris, or electrical issues can disrupt these components, making the appliance less reliable and increasing the risk of flooding during operation.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ent these issues before they lead to costly water damage.

What are the signs that my dishwasher is about to overflow?

Signs include water pooling around the appliance during a cycle, unusual noises, or water leakage under or around the dishwasher. Regular maintenance can help identify issues early before an overflow occurs.
